,可以通过以下步骤实现:
- 使用Xamarin.Forms提供的控件对象,例如Label、Button等,创建窗体界面。
- 在代码中,可以通过控件对象的Width属性来获取控件的实际宽度。例如,如果有一个名为myLabel的Label控件,可以使用myLabel.Width来获取其实际宽度。
- 如果需要在运行时动态获取控件的宽度,可以在适当的时机(例如窗体加载完成后)使用事件或方法来获取控件的宽度。例如,可以在窗体的OnAppearing事件中使用myLabel.Width来获取myLabel控件的实际宽度。
- 获取到控件的实际宽度后,可以根据需要进行进一步的处理,例如根据宽度调整其他控件的位置或大小。
Xamarin是一种跨平台移动应用开发框架,它允许开发者使用C#语言和.NET平台来创建iOS、Android和Windows等多个平台的应用程序。Xamarin.Forms是Xamarin提供的一种UI框架,用于创建跨平台的用户界面。
Xamarin窗体控件的实际宽度获取可以应用于各种场景,例如根据控件的宽度来自适应布局、根据控件的宽度来动态调整其他控件的位置或大小等。
腾讯云提供了一系列云计算产品,其中与移动应用开发相关的产品包括腾讯移动推送、腾讯移动分析等。这些产品可以帮助开发者实现移动应用的推送、统计分析等功能。具体产品介绍和相关链接如下:
- 腾讯移动推送:提供移动应用消息推送服务,支持Android和iOS平台。详细信息请参考腾讯移动推送。
- 腾讯移动分析:提供移动应用数据统计分析服务,帮助开发者了解用户行为和应用性能。详细信息请参考腾讯移动分析。
以上是关于在代码背后获取Xamarin窗体控件的实际宽度的答案。希望对您有所帮助!